Government announced Bharat Ratna for Sachin Tendulkar

sachin_bharat_ratanNew Delhi: The Government has decided to confer the Bharat Ratna, the highest civilian award, on eminent scientist Prof C.N.R.Rao and cricket legend Sachin Tendulkar. The Prime Minister’s office made the announcement on Saturday afternoon.

Tendulkar is a living legend who has inspired millions across the globe. During the last 24 years, since the young age of 16 years, Tendulkar has played cricket across the world and won laurels for our country. He has been a true ambassador of India in the world of sports.

His achievements in cricket are unparalleled, the records set by him unmatched, and the spirit of sportsmanship displayed by him exemplary. That he has been honored with several awards is testimony to his extraordinary brilliance as a sportsman,” the PMO statement read.

BCCI Vice-President Rajeev Shukla had, earlier this week, said that there was a demand to give Sachin the honour. This demand is there for last 2-3 years. But it cannot be done when someone is playing, there may be some controversy. Now that he is retiring, we will try that he gets it. Hopefully, the committee (that decides) and the government will consider,” Shukla said.

Tendulkar bows out as the most successful batsman in international cricket with 15,921 runs in 200 Tests. In his ODI career, which he needed last year, Tendulkar amassed 18,426 runs in 463 matches. The award is a perfect send off gift to Tendulkar whose career spanned 24 years making him an inspiration for an entire generation of cricketer.

Tendulkar, who became the first active sportsperson to become a Rajya Sabha member last year, is being given the honour along with Professor C N R Rao, the man behind India`s maiden Mars mission.
